Mastering Business Casual: A Modern Guide for Women

The shifting landscape of workplace attire can be quite confusing for women. While the classic suit and tie may still hold sway in specific industries, most offices today embrace a more flexible dress code known as business casual. This offers freedom to express personal style while maintaining a professional appearance.

The key to conquering business casual lies in understanding the details of this dress code. It's about striking the perfect equilibrium between smart and comfortable.

Consider your workplace environment when making your wardrobe choices. A artistic industry may allow for more vibrant looks, while a traditional environment may require a more sophisticated approach.

Here are some essential guidelines to help you excel in the world of business casual:

* **Invest in well-fitting pieces:** Garments that fits properly will always look more polished.

* **Choose fabrics wisely:** Opt for high-quality materials like cotton, linen, silk, or wool.

* **Pay attention to details:** Finishing details can make a big difference. A statement necklace or a well-chosen scarf can elevate a simple outfit.

* **Don't be afraid to experiment:** Business casual allows for self-expression. Have fun with your wardrobe and find what suits you best.

By following these guidelines, you can confidently navigate the world of business casual and create a wardrobe that is both competent and fashionable.

Business Casual for Women : Dress to Impress in Comfort

Finding the perfect balance between professionalism and comfort can be a challenge when navigating the world of business casual. Fortunately, there are plenty of stylish choices that allow women to look polished and put-together without sacrificing relaxation. A key tip is to choose elegant pieces that can be easily combined for a variety of occasions.

Consider incorporating items like well-fitting blouses, tailored pants, midi skirts, and blazers into your wardrobe. These building blocks can be dressed up or down depending on the situation. For example, a crisp white blouse paired with dark blue trousers is perfect for a conference, while the same blouse with a denim skirt adds a more casual vibe for after-work drinks.

Don't forget to pay attention to accessories. A scarf can elevate your look, while stylish shoes are essential for all-day wearability. Remember, confidence is the ultimate accessory! Embrace your personal style and choose outfits that make you feel both confident.

Dissecting Business Professional Attire: The Ultimate Guide

Navigating the realm of business professional attire can be tricky, especially when deciphering the subtle nuances that separate a polished look from a potentially inappropriate one. However, fear not! This comprehensive guide aims to clarify the complexities of dressing for success in the corporate world. Whether you're preparing for a significant interview, attending a networking event, or simply striving to project an image of competence and professionalism in your daily work environment, these tips will serve as your compass to sartorial excellence.

First and foremost, remember that business professional attire is not merely about wearing expensive garments. It's about conveying a message of respect, self-belief, and attention to detail. This involves adhering to certain guidelines regarding texture, fit, and enhancements.

Let's delve into the key elements that constitute a truly business professional wardrobe:

  • Business Jackets: A classic suit is the cornerstone of any professional wardrobe. Opt for neutral colors such as navy, gray, or black, and ensure a well-tailored fit.
  • Blouses: Choose crisp, clean shirts in white, light blue, or subtle patterns. Pay attention to the collar style and sleeve length for a polished presentation.
  • Trousers: Your trousers or skirt should be tailored and of appropriate length. Avoid overly tight or revealing styles. For women, consider pencil skirts or straight-leg pants that fall at the ankle.
  • Shoes: Opt for polished leather shoes in black or brown. Closed-toe heels are generally preferred for women, while men can choose dress shoes or loafers.

Finally, remember that balance is key when it comes to accessories. A simple watch, a discreet necklace, or elegant earrings are sufficient to complete your professional ensemble without appearing overdressed.

By following these guidelines, you can confidently navigate the world of business professional attire and make a lasting impression with your sartorial choices.
